Postal Unions Protest Over Future of SA Post Office

View descriptionShare
 

The Communication Workers Union and its allies will hold a national shutdown and march today to demand action on the Post Office crisis. Workers want R3.8 billion in urgent funding, a 30% government business allocation, job security and an end to the Business Rescue Process. A memorandum will be handed to the Communications Minister and National Treasury in Pretoria. The unions say SAPO is a public lifeline and warn of escalation if demands are ignored. We spoke to  Bokaba Kodisang, General Secretary of Democratic Postal and Communication Union (DEPACU)
